Why Cave Junction Homes Need a Local Garage Door Specialist
Cave Junction sits in a unique pocket of southern Oregon where the Illinois Valley meets the Siskiyou Mountains. The area gets more rain than people expect (around 60 inches annually), and that moisture works its way into garage door components over time. Rust on springs, warped wooden doors, and corroded tracks are common issues we see throughout Cave Junction neighborhoods.
The housing stock here is diverse. You've got everything from newer manufactured homes to older ranch-style properties built in the 1960s and 70s. Many homes still have their original garage doors, which means we're often dealing with outdated hardware that needs full replacement rather than just repair. Single-car garages are common in older Cave Junction homes, while newer construction typically features two-car or even three-car setups.
Winter temperatures dip below freezing regularly, and that cold causes metal components to contract. Springs that might have months of life left in warmer weather can snap overnight when temperatures drop into the 20s. We also see garage door openers struggle more in Cave Junction's climate because the cold thickens lubricants and makes motors work harder.
What We Do for Cave Junction Homeowners
Our most common call in Cave Junction is for broken torsion springs. These springs do the heavy lifting (literally, they counterbalance 150+ pounds), and they typically last 7 to 9 years, not the 10 years some manufacturers claim. We carry high-cycle springs on every truck, so we can complete most spring replacement jobs in under two hours from arrival to testing.
Garage door opener installation is our second most requested service. We install and service all major brands including L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ie. If your opener is more than 12 years old, replacement usually makes more sense than repair. Modern openers have better safety features, smartphone connectivity, and battery backup systems that keep working during power outages (which happen in Cave Junction, especially during winter storms).
Cable and roller repairs are straightforward but dangerous if you don't know what you're doing. Cables are under extreme tension, and rollers that come off track can cause the door to fall. We handle these repairs safely and quickly.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are dented beyond repair, the door frame is damaged, or you're dealing with an old wooden door that's rotted through. We'll walk you through material options (steel, aluminum, composite) and insulation values that make sense for Cave Junction's climate.

What's the most common garage door problem in Cave Junction?
Broken torsion springs account for about 60% of our Cave Junction calls. The combination of moisture and temperature swings wears them out. We also see a lot of opener issues, particularly with older units that struggle in cold weather. Rust on hardware is more common here than in drier parts of Oregon.
How much does spring replacement cost in Cave Junction?
Most residential spring replacements run between $195 and $350 depending on door size and spring type. Two-car garage doors obviously cost more than single-car. We replace both springs even if only one broke because the other is the same age and will fail soon. You can see our full FAQ for more pricing details.
